Top The Metro Apartments | Reviews & Ratings | comparemela.com
The metro apartments in United states - 80202/ near denver/ near denver
The metro apartments in United states - 40160/ near hardin
The metro apartments in United states - 20785/ near prince-george-s
The metro apartments in United states - 55402/ near hennepin
The metro apartments in Australia - / near hunter
The metro apartments in India - 682001/ near ernakulam